Telltale president and co-founder Kevin Bruner would like to make a James Bond game if he were ever afforded the chance.


"I'm a giant James Bond fan and I'm always frustrated by games that make him a mass murderer," Bruner told OXM when asked which license he'd adapt if money and licensing hurdles were not a factor.


"He's a super-spy, and that's a different skillset," he explained. "The films make him less of a mass murderer, and there's not much killing in the books – more spying and intrigue."
